What Happens During a Vet Check-Up?
During a typical vet check-up, your pet will undergo a thorough physical examination. The veterinarian will assess their weight, listen to their heart and lungs, check their eyes, ears, and teeth, and evaluate their overall condition. This comprehensive examination is designed to detect subtle changes in your pet’s health that can indicate underlying issues.
Moreover, your veterinarian will inquire about your pet’s behavior and habits at home, which can provide critical insights into their health. This is also an excellent opportunity for pet owners to ask questions or express concerns about their pet’s diet, exercise, or behavior. Blood tests and other diagnostic screenings might also be recommended based on your pet’s age, breed, and lifestyle. These tests provide valuable information that goes beyond what can be observed externally, such as internal health concerns.

Ensuring Safety and Security
Another critical aspect of responsible pet ownership is ensuring the safety and security of pets. This includes creating a safe home environment by removing hazards such as toxic plants, electrical cords, and small objects that could be swallowed. Additionally, securing indoor and outdoor spaces to prevent pets from escaping and encountering potential dangers is essential. It’s also wise to equip pets with identification tags or microchips, which significantly improve the chances of a safe return should they ever become lost. By taking these precautions, pet owners can safeguard their beloved animals from preventable accidents and losses.

Understanding Pet Nutrition
The foundation of a pet’s health is proper nutrition. Just like humans, pets require a balanced diet that includes proteins, fats, carbohydrates, vitamins, and minerals. These nutrients are vital for growth, energy, and overall health. Proteins support muscle development, fats are essential for energy, and carbohydrates provide necessary fiber. Vitamins and minerals are critical for immune function and internal balance.
The Risks of Poor Nutrition
Poor nutrition can lead to numerous health issues in pets. Obesity, one of the most common problems, can cause joint pain, diabetes, and a shortened lifespan. A deficiency in essential nutrients can also result in conditions such as skin disorders, weak immune systems, and digestive issues. Consequently, choosing the right diet can profoundly impact your pet’s quality of life and longevity.
Choosing the Right Food
Selecting the best food for your pet can be overwhelming with the myriad of options available on the market. Understanding pet food labels and ingredients is crucial. Consider your pet’s age, breed, size, and any specific health conditions they might have. Consulting with a veterinarian can provide valuable insights into your pet’s unique nutritional needs. Opt for high-quality commercial food, or consider preparing homemade meals, ensuring they are rich in essential nutrients.
The Role of Hydration
While focusing on food, it’s vital not to overlook the necessity of hydration. Water is fundamental for digestion, nutrient absorption, and regulating body temperature. Always ensure your pet has access to clean, fresh water to prevent dehydration, which can lead to serious health complications.
Supplements: To Include or Not?
Supplements can be beneficial, but they are not always necessary for every pet. They can enhance a balanced diet, especially for pets with specific health concerns. However, it’s vital to consult a veterinarian before introducing supplements to avoid potential overdoses or imbalances.
